  • To be good is to be forgotten. I'm going to be so bad I'll always be remembered.

    "The Confessions of Theda Bara" by Agnes Smith, Photoplay Magazine, Vol. 18 No. 1 (pp. 57 - 58, 110 - 111), June 1920.
  • I have the face of a vampire, but the heart of a feminist.

    "Biography/ Personal Quotes". www.imdb.com.
  • Once on the streets of New York a woman called the police because her child spoke to me.

    "Personal Quotes/ Biography". www.imdb.com.
  • You say I have the most wicked face of any woman. You say my hair is like the serpent locks of Medusa, that my eyes have the cruel cunning of Borgia, that my mouth is the mouth of the sinister scheming Delilah, that my hands are like the talons of a Circe or the blood-bathing Elizabeth Bathory. And then you ask me of my soul—you wish to know if it is reflected in my face.

  • The reason good women like me and flock to my pictures is that there is a little bit of vampire instinct in every woman.

  • During the rest of my screen career, I am going to continue doing vampires as long as people sin. For I believe that humanity needs the moral lesson and it needs it in repeatedly larger doses.
